arm: move image_copy_start/end to linker symbols
image_copy_start/end are defined as c variables in order to force the compiler emit relative references. However, defining those within a section definition will do the same thing since [0]. So let's remove the special sections from the linker scripts, the variable definitions from sections.c and define them as a symbols within a section.
